PRADEEP NANDRAJOG, J.
1. The matter was listed for September 13, 2016 which was declared a holiday and therefore is being taken up today.
2. The petitioner by way of present petition prays quashing of the criminal complaint bearing CC No.1780/1 (old number CC 3864/11) and CC No.1781/1 (old number CC 3864/11/2011) under Section 138 read with Section 141 of the Negotiable Instruments Act (hereinafter referred to as ‘Act’), titled Countrywide Promoters Pvt. Ltd. Vs. Era Landmarks Ltd. & Ors., and the summoning orders dated March 01, 2011 and May 14, 2013 and all proceedings arising there from.
3. The brief facts necessitating the disposal of the present petitions are that the accused company, in which the petitioner was alleged to be a director, entered into an MOU with the Complainant Company/respondent No.2 for development of a parcel of land in Haryana. Pursuant to the MOU, a Development Rights Agreement dated April 13, 2007 was entered into between the parties and subsequently a Share Purchase Agreement dated May 05, 2008 was entered into between the parties.
